Element isolation

from class:

Photojournalism II

Definition

Element isolation refers to the technique used in photography and photo editing where specific elements within an image are separated from their backgrounds or surrounding details to draw attention to them. This method enhances the focus on the main subject, allowing viewers to engage more deeply with the intended focal point of the image. It often involves using advanced selection tools or techniques to create a clean separation, making it easier to manipulate or highlight certain parts of the photo.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Element isolation helps in emphasizing the subject by removing distracting elements from the frame, leading to a clearer narrative.
  2. Using techniques like feathering edges during selection can create smoother transitions when isolating elements.
  3. This method is commonly used in commercial photography, where products need to stand out against plain or contrasting backgrounds.
  4. The use of element isolation can enhance storytelling in photojournalism by focusing on key subjects and their contexts within a scene.
  5. Mastering element isolation techniques can significantly improve one's overall composition skills and image impact.

  • Discuss how layer masks can be utilized in conjunction with element isolation to enhance photographic compositions.
    • Layer masks are a powerful tool that can complement element isolation by allowing for precise control over which parts of an image are visible. When isolating an element, layer masks enable photographers to refine edges and blend the isolated element into new backgrounds seamlessly. This combination results in more polished and visually compelling compositions that effectively highlight key subjects without harsh cut lines or abrupt transitions.
